Founded in 1754 as King’s College, Columbia University is a preeminent private Ivy League research university accredited by the Middle States Commission on Higher Education. Its academic offerings span diverse fields, including business, engineering, law, medicine, arts and sciences, journalism, and public health—all upheld by rigorous research and world-class faculty, serving over 33,000 students worldwide.
Columbia’s MSc in Financial Economics is a standout 2-year STEM-eligible program housed in Columbia Business School, offering rigorous PhD and MBA-level coursework in econometrics, empirical asset pricing, and machine learning. With 48 credits, a mandatory summer internship, and focus on quantitative finance, it prepares graduates for roles in investment banks, asset management firms, and economic consulting. The university’s broader Finance-related MSc programs also include climate finance, blending financial management with climate science for industry relevance.
